Pair take deliveryman's cash, car
Police are searching for two suspects they say robbed a Chinese food deliveryman Wednesday night in Elmont.
The robbers not only stole $300 in cash, but also the deliveryman's car, police said.
The victim, 48, suffered a lacerated nose when one of the robbers punched him in the face, Nassau County police said.
He refused medical attention for his injury, police said.
The incident occurred at 9:40 p.m. on Butler Boulevard.
Police said the victim parked his car across the street from the address given, walked to the front gate of the home -- and was approached from behind by one of the suspects, who put him in a choke hold.
The second robber then punched the victim in the face and stole $300 from his pocket.
The two then stole the victim's 2001 gray Nissan Sentra and fled south on Butler, then west onto Surprise Street. The car has New York plates DVP 3773.
Police said both suspects were about 5-foot-9 with thin builds. One wore a dark hooded sweatshirt, while the other also wore dark clothing.
